Company Description
House of Task (Pty) Ltd is a black woman-owned company in the creative design industry, specializing in high-end luxury interiors for retail, hospitality, commercial, and residential projects.

Through collaboration with designers, architects, artists, and service providers, we deliver sophisticated and stylish interior design solutions.

House of Task acquired Eminent Designs to expand its services into project management, shopfitting, and construction, emphasizing the selection of superior materials and carpentry solutions.

Role Description
This is a full-time on-site role as a General Manager at House of Task in Sandton.

The General Manager will be responsible for overseeing the company's operations, managing projects, leading teams, developing strategies for growth, and ensuring the delivery of high-quality interior design, shopfitting, and construction services. The General Manager needs to have a good technical knowledge of the building design and construction industry.

Good management and business development skills are essential to this role. A desire to manage successful projects that achieve the required criteria of time, cost, and quality is of utmost importance.

Qualifications
- A Bachelor's degree in Interior Design, Architecture, Business, or related field
- Project Management, Team Leadership, and Strategic Planning skills
- Experience in the interior design, construction, or related industry
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
- Financial Management and Budgeting skills
- Experience in business development and client relationship management
- Knowledge of design software and industry trends
- Minimum of at least 5 years of experience in a managerial role

Key Responsibilities
- Manage, monitor and report progress of the works for all in-house projects
- All project administration i.e. liaising with clients, contractors, suppliers and other co-workers
- Project co-ordination and management of projects, contractors and professional teams for internal units / portfolios
- Research, develop and implement systems, procedures and structures that would enhance the functioning and productivity of House of Task and ensure policies and procedures are implemented consistently
- Keep abreast of market trends to ensure optimum decision-making
- Respond to and resolve a wide range of queries, channeling to the appropriate area as necessary
- General housekeeping with regards to studio admin, archiving and daily processes
- Design Implementation: Manage all aspects of projects, from concepts, project management to completion
- Compile and oversee full drawing packs and conceptual designs.
- Ensure that role-players approve projects
- Drive projects independently, do schemes, presentation boards and consult with clients
- Verify that design projects comply with all statutory and building regulations.
- Redline and get approval from Management on technical packs before issuing
- Taking and checking on site measurement for space planning and design
- Must be able to work under pressure, have attention to detail, process concepts & information accurately
- Meeting with contractors on site
- Compile full specification documents and assist in council submissions.
- Quantity Surveyor: Manage, monitor and report progress of the costings for all in-house projects
- Liaison with the QS in terms of costings
- Review, recommend and implement systems that will ensure seamless workflow in the QS department
- Set and monitor timelines for deliverables
- Compile weekly overall reports for the management to be updated on the costing progress for all projects
